I Loved, I Lost, I Made Spaghetti, by Guilia Melucci
This is a fast-paced, humorous book that is part love story, part memoir, and part cookbook. Halfway through the book I was calling my female friends and relatives to tell them to read this book! Guilia has a knack for always picking the wrong man. Through her ups and downs with failed relationships, she recognizes the need to move on with life and go with the flow, cooking and laughing all the way. The reader will find themselves laughing out loud, and spending more time in the kitchen while reading this book, as the author includes several tempting recipes throughout her chronicles.
